The Memphis International Raceway, a motorsports facility covering 342 acres, is located just ten minutes from Millington, Tennessee. It is a major racing destination in Mid-South. It hosts many events, including drag racing and NASCAR Nationwide Series. In 2009, Jason Line won the NHRA nation event at the track. AutoZone is a major supplier and manufacturer of tires. The facility is close to historic Graceland.

Since the mid-1980s, Memphis International Raceway has been an integral part of the Mid-South drag-racing scene. Its 1.9-mile road circuit is divided into two segments. Six out of eight turns are located on the east side. Each corner features 11 degrees bank. The straights of the track are 3500 feet long.

There is also a drag strip measuring 4,400 feet. The track is located near the Charles W Baker Airport in Millington, Tennessee, and is close to the Loosahatchie River. Memphis International Raceway hosts street racing and night racing. It also offers Test-N-Tune sessions that allow street legal vehicles to be tuned. It is also home to the IHRA Summit SuperSeries racer competition.
